Typical Price Range

$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)

$3,000 - $6,500 (Larger scope)

Project Type Typical Range
Walk-in Shower Conversion $1,200 - $2,800
Full Bathroom Remodel $4,000 - $6,500
Shower Seat Installation $600 - $1,200
Grab Bar Installation $150 - $400
Barrier-Free Shower $3,000 - $6,500
Shower Door Replacement $800 - $2,000

Material quality, shower type, and accessibility features influence costs.

Installing an accessible shower designed for elderly individuals in Hillsborough County, FL, involves selecting appropriate materials, ensuring proper sizing, and adhering to local regulations.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for safety and convenience.

  • Materials: Common choices include slip-resistant tiles, low-threshold bases, and waterproof wall panels suitable for aging-in-place modifications.
  • Size and Scope: Standard accessible showers often range from 36 to 48 inches in width, with features like built-in seating or grab bars added as needed.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ation may involve plumbing adjustments, waterproofing, and possible modifications to existing bathroom structures, affecting overall complexity.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Hillsborough County typically require permits for bathroom modifications, especially when structural or plumbing changes are involved.
  • Extras: Additional features such as handheld showerheads, anti-slip flooring, and accessible controls can be included to enhance safety and usability.

Project size depends on bathroom layout and needs

Scope/Size Typical Range
Standard Walk-In Shower $3,000 - $7,000
Wheelchair-Accessible Shower $5,000 - $12,000
Shower with Grab Bars and Seating $4,000 - $9,000
Customized Accessible Shower $8,000 - $15,000

Project costs in Hillsborough County, FL, can vary based on the scope and specific accessibility features selected.
